I'm trying to research this build too. So far what I've got its the motor to gear ratio is 3.75:1, although it may be 4:1 or something close because the video keeps warping. The motor seems to be a Lynch motor, specifically a LEM-200. The person who owns this channel seems to lost the password, because he replied and hearted comments that were left up until 4 years ago, and then abruptly stopped. Imma go on forums and see if they know anything. I'll keep us updated. Update: When I got my first calculations, I used a screenshot from 0:06. Now I just measured a way clearer screenshot from 2:07, and the gear ratio is exactly 3:1. Edit 2: He's using a Nissan leaf battery. It burned up in May 2017.
